What is DTF Printing? The Technical Breakdown

DTF printing is an advanced digital printing technique that employs producing designs on unique PET film using eco-friendly inks and bonding powder. In contrast to conventional techniques, DTF transfers can be applied to multiple fabric types from natural to synthetic without pre-treatment. This versatility makes DTF printer technology highly sought-after among entrepreneurs looking for efficient, high-quality printing options.

The method produces prints that are both remarkably beautiful but also incredibly durable. DTF transfers withstand wear and tear even after multiple washes, making them perfect for commercial applications where durability is paramount. With the ability to reproduce intricate designs, gradients, and photo-quality graphics, DTF printing opens up limitless creative possibilities for your operation.

How to Create DTF Transfers: Step-by-Step Guide

Producing commercial-grade DTF transfers demands mastering each step of the workflow. Here's a thorough breakdown:

1. Creating Your Design

Start by developing your graphic using design programs like Photoshop, CorelDRAW, or simpler options like Canva or Procreate. Output your design as a crisp PNG file with a transparent background. The benefit of DTF printing is that you can use intricate full-color artwork without concerning yourself with color restrictions.

2. Creating the Transfer

Input your design into the DTF printer program. The printer will first lay down the color layers (CMYK) directly onto the PET film, subsequently applying a white ink layer that acts as a base. This white layer is vital for guaranteeing bright hues on dark fabrics. Modern DTF printer models can attain speeds of up to impressive output speeds, making them ideal for high-volume production.

3. Powder Application

While the ink is still fresh, evenly apply hot-melt adhesive powder over the entire printed design. This powder is what bonds the DTF transfer to the fabric during the transfer process. Use a see-saw motion to achieve complete coverage, then shake off any excess powder. Many operations are now purchasing automated powder shakers for consistent results.

4. Heat Setting

The adhesive powder needs to be heat-activated before application. This can be done using a heat tunnel (recommended for optimal results) or by hovering under a heat press. Curing typically takes 1-2 minutes in an oven at the appropriate temperature. Adequate curing allows your DTF transfers can be preserved for later use or applied immediately.

5. Heat Press Application

First press your garment for 10 seconds to prepare the fabric. Place your DTF transfer on the fabric and press at 325°F (165°C) for 15-20 seconds with balanced pressure. The heat engages the adhesive, forming a lasting connection between the design and fabric.

6. Peeling and Final Press

Following application, peel the film while it's still warm in one continuous action. This warm removal method provides clean edges and eliminates unwanted lines in your design. Finally, perform a second press for another short duration to boost durability and decrease shine.

The Rise of DTF Technology Current Growth

The DTF printing market has witnessed remarkable expansion, valued at nearly $3 billion in 2024 and forecast to reach almost $4 billion by 2030. This remarkable expansion is powered by several important elements:

Exceptional Adaptability

In contrast with other printing processes, DTF transfers function with almost every fabric type without pre-treatment. From pure cotton to artificial fabrics, various materials, DTF printing ensures consistent, high-quality results across all substrates.

Flexible Order Quantities

When producing one custom shirt or bulk orders, DTF printer technology abolishes preparation fees and minimum quantities. This flexibility makes it perfect for on-demand printing, individual designs, and design experimentation without monetary commitment.

Premium Results

Current DTF printing generates incredibly detailed, bright graphics that equal or beat traditional methods. The technology performs best with generating detailed photographs, complex gradients, and fine details that would be challenging with other methods.

Economic Efficiency

With minimal startup expenses than screen printing and quicker turnaround than DTG printing, DTF transfers deliver an excellent ROI. The ability to gang multiple designs on a one film further reduces costs and material waste.

Necessary Hardware for Successful Operations

To start your DTF printing business, you'll need the following machinery:

  • Transfer Printer: Pick between specialized printers by manufacturers like Epson, Roland, and Mimaki, or adapt existing printers for DTF printing
  • Transfer Inks: Formulated textile inks developed for optimal adhesion and color intensity
  • Transfer Film: Sold in rolls or sheets, with hot-peel or cold-peel options
  • Transfer Powder: Light powder for most uses, alternative powder for dark designs on dark fabrics
  • Heat Press: Commercial-grade press with reliable temperature and pressure
  • Powder Dryer: For optimal powder curing (highly recommended)
  • Color Management Software: For print optimization and print optimization
